Incriminating

the GNU version of the Collaborative International Dictionary of English
  • adjective. charging or suggestive of guilt or blame.
  • Wiktionary, Creative Commons Attribution/Share-Alike License
  • adjective. Causing, showing, or proving that one is guilty of wrongdoing.
  • verb. Present participle of incriminate.
